Radiation dosimetry of <sup>15</sup>O-water based on dynamic large axial field of view PET

Listen to this summary

The authors aimed to provide more accurate estimates of radiation dosimetry for <sup>15</sup>O-water using dynamic large axial field of view (LAFOV) PET scanning, as previous estimates were based on limited data. Their findings revealed a sex-averaged effective dose coefficient of 0.62 μSv/MBq, leading to a significantly lower effective dose of approximately 0.25 mSv for typical cardiac scans, compared to earlier estimates. This suggests that LAFOV PET can enhance dosimetry accuracy for this radiotracer.
